      Meaning of the first name Linell

      Origin

      English or Scandinavian

      Meaning

      Possibly Derived from Linnet (a Bird)

      Variations

      Linelle, Lanell, Lonell
      The name Linell is believed to have English or Scandinavian roots and is possibly derived from the term linnet, which refers to a small, lively songbird known for its cheerful singing. The etymology of the name reflects both nature and grace, embodying qualities associated with the bird itself. Linell, while not among the most common names, carries a unique charm and a connection to the natural world that appeals to many.
